Referral #5860:
Introduction
The present WSC system of processing referrals and discussing and adopting proposals excludes CA groups and their members from any involvement in the decision making process. As a result of this the collective conscience of CA cannot be truly expressed and the ultimate authority cannot be fully exercised. As stated in Tradition 2 and Concept I both of these should lie with the groups. To ensure the survival and growth of Cocaine Anonymous the vital link between the CA groups and the WSC must be established. The following proposal is aimed at addressing this shortfall.
Proposal
That the WSC appoint a committee to receive, review, modify and select referrals for inclusion on the agenda of the following year’s WSC.
- That the following WSC members be considered for inclusion in this committee: WSC chairperson, WSC cosecretaries, all WSC committee chairpersons and for guidance, support and continuity 2 WSBT members and the WSOB chairperson
- That WSC set a deadline for submission of referrals from the fellowship to this committee.
- That WSC set guidelines for the selection process of submitted referrals.
- That WSC give a name to the document containing the selected referrals to be sent out to the fellowship. A possible name could be “Questions for World Service Conference”

e) That WSC set a deadline for sending out “Questions for World Service Conference” to the fellowship. This date should allow sufficient time for groups to discuss the questions and pass on their conscience to their Delegates. A suggested deadline could be no later than the beginning of March to allow sufficient time to facilitate this discussion process.
f) That WSC decide on a manner of sending out the “Questions for World Service Conference” to the fellowship. A suitable method could be direct mailing to all WSC Delegates and inclusion in the first quarter edition of NewsGram.
Additional background information
Concept III gives the WSC and participating delegates the right of decision on how to vote and which questions it will deal with on its own responsibilities and which it will refer to the groups for opinion or for definite guidance. However Concept III also states that this should not be “an excuse for persistently failing to consult those who are entitled to be consulted before any important decision or action is taken” (The Twelve Concepts for World Service p15-16).
In the present system the WSC persistently fails to consult the groups before important decisions are made and actions taken.
Although Delegates can and should vote according to their own conscience there should be some means by which the Groups share their views on important issues prior to annual WSC meeting.
Under the proposed system Delegates would arrive at the WSC knowing their groups’ views on the referrals included on the agenda for discussion and voting. Referring to Delegates, Concept IX states that “These are the direct agents of the CA groups, these are the primary representatives of CA’s group conscience” (The Twelve Concepts for World Service p36.)

In the interest of transparency and trust, Delegates, as trusted servants, report back to the Groups in their respective Area Assemblies on how they voted regarding various proposals, and why. Under the proposed process, the groups would be in a far better position to hold Delegates to account as they have had the opportunity to view and discuss referrals and exercise their Ultimate authority and if needs be, in exceptional circumstances, to replace a delegate.
The proposed alterations to WSC procedures would restore the vital link between the groups and the WSC. This link was in Bill W’s view vital for the survival of AA and in my view is just as vital for the survival of CA.
Response: The Conference Committee appreciates the spirit of the referral. The committee will be cooperating with the WSO as we address the process and guidelines to fulfill this idea.
